Course Details

Tennis Data Analysis Fundamentals: Understanding the basics of tennis data analysis, including data collection, cleaning, and visualization.
Tennis Statistics and Metrics: Learning the key statistics and metrics used in tennis, such as serve percentage, return of serve, and break points.
Player Performance Analysis: Analyzing the performance of individual tennis players, including strengths, weaknesses, and trends over time.
Match Analysis and Predictive Modeling: Using data to analyze individual matches and develop predictive models for future matches.
Tennis Market Research and Data Insights: Understanding the tennis market and using data insights to inform business decisions.
Data Visualization and Reporting: Presenting tennis data in a clear and effective way, including creating charts, graphs, and reports.
Tennis Data Ethics and Privacy: Exploring the ethical considerations surrounding tennis data, including privacy concerns and responsible data use.
Emerging Trends in Tennis Data: Staying up-to-date with the latest trends and developments in tennis data, including new data sources, technologies, and analytics techniques.

Career Path

In the UK job market, tennis data careers in the sports business sector are thriving. With the increased demand for data-driven decision-making in sports organizations, various roles have emerged as key contributors to this industry. Here are some prominent tennis data careers: 1. **Data Analyst**: These professionals collect, process, and interpret tennis data for teams, leagues, and broadcast networks, driving strategic decisions and on-air insights. 2. **Data Scientist**: Data scientists utilize advanced statistical modeling and machine learning techniques to uncover hidden patterns, inform player development, and predict match outcomes. 3. **Business Intelligence Developer**: These specialists create data visualizations and reporting tools, enabling sports organizations to make informed decisions and improve operational efficiency. 4. **Data Engineer**: Data engineers build and maintain data pipelines, ensuring high-quality, real-time data for tennis-related analytics and insights. 5. **Sports Statistician**: Statisticians analyze and interpret tennis match data, generating valuable insights for players, coaches, and sports broadcasters.
